IC560DHC
IC560DHC is specially designed for enterprises that mainly produce multi-layer roll materials and artificial leather, and a small amount of genuine leather processing, especially suitable for the following scenarios:
Main production with artificial leather/roll materials: In industries such as footwear, handbags (bags), and fashion accessories, production lines that need to cut multi-layer PU, PVC, artificial leather and other roll materials in batches can be used as core cutting equipment for large-scale production.
Small amount of leather supplementary processing: When enterprises receive small batch orders made of leather (such as high-end shoes, customized handbags), or need to produce leather accessories, they can quickly switch to leather cutting mode without additional equipment.
Multi-categories mixed production: For enterprises that produce artificial leather and genuine leather products at the same time, there is no need to apply two separate pieces of equipment, one can cover the cutting needs of two materials, simplifying the production process and avoiding machine idle time and waste of resources.
The core machine configuration and functions:
Core hardware composition: It consists of two multi-functional cutter heads (which can adapt to different material cutting needs), a circulation conveyor belt (for continuous transportation of materials and improve mass production efficiency), a leather rack (to facilitate the storage and unwinding of rolled materials), and a projection stand (to support leather cutting correction). The machine is compact in size and has a clear division of functions.
Intelligent operation: with a full computer operation control page, the workflow is intuitive and easy to understand. Support fully automatic intelligent conveying which reduces manual intervention and operation errors. At the same time, it has a super nesting function, which can optimize material nesting, reduce waste generation and material costs.
Compatibility and adaptability: It can accept a variety of mainstream design software file formats such as PLT, CUT, DXF, etc., without the need for additional file conversion, connecting design and production links. Supports cutting up to 4-12 layers of rolled material with an average cutting speed of 1,500 knives per hour, balancing mass production with efficiency.
Convenient switching of leather cutting: When it is necessary to cut the leather, you only need to install a projector on the projection stand, and the nesting results can be accurately positioned and corrected through the projection, and you can quickly switch to the leather cutting mode, without complex debugging, to ensure the accuracy of leather cutting.
Smart Leather Cutting Machine
Model | IC560DHC |
Machine dimension | 5560*2200*2600mm |
Double working areas | 1500*1600mm |
Max. Cutting speed | 84米/分钟 |
Power | phase 200-400VAC 50-60HZ,12.5KW Monophase200-240VAC 50-60HZ,2KW |
Air consumption | 4-6Pa |
